Or you can take a train to Clapham and change onto a Watford service - but those are only once an hour I think, so it depends if you're lucky

 

Safest best is probably North London line to Willesden Junction, Bakerloo line to Harrow & Wealdstone and then a train from there

65 Bus to Ealing Broadway 30 mins

EB to Paddington 12 mins

Circle line to Euston Sq 15mins

walk from Euston Sq to Euston 3 mins

Euston to Watford Junc 20 mins

 

= 80 mins

Just take the first train going North from willesden. If it's the Bakerloo you change as Will says. If it's the Silverlink metro, you stay on to Watford Junction. And wave to me as you go past.
